Severo Aparicio Quispe

Severo Aparicio Quispe breath ( born October 8, 1923 in San Pedro de Lloc, † May 6, 2013 in Cusco ) was a Roman Catholic theologian and church historian and Bishop of Cuzco.

Life

Severo Aparicio Quispe joined after attending school in Sicuani and Cuzco, the Congregation of the Mercedarians. He studied theology and education at the Pontifical Catholic University of Chile and graduated with a degree in theology as well as high school teacher for languages ​​from. He received on 22 September 1951, the ordination. At the Pontifical Gregorian University in Rome, he completed a doctoral study of church history.

He taught at the Colegio San Pedro Nolasco de Santiago de Chile and was a Fellow at the Library of Congress in Washington, DC. He was provincial of his order in Cuzco and taught at the Universidad Nacional de San Antonio Abad del Cusco. After a Tätogkeit for his Order in Rome he became professor of church history at the Facultad de Teología Pontificia y Civil de Lima. From 1977 to 1978 he was Deputy Secretary-General of the Peruvian Episcopal Conference.

Pope John Paul II appointed him auxiliary bishop on 11 December 1978 in Cuzco and Titular Bishop of Vegesela in Numidia. The Archbishop of Lima, Cardinal Juan Landázuri Ricketts, OFM, ordained him on the 4th of March of the following year to the bishop; Co-consecrators were Luis Vallejos Santoni, Archbishop of Cuzco, and Lorenzo León Alvarado breath, Bishop of Huacho.

In 1986, he was the founding director of the Peruvian Institute of Church History (Instituto Peruano de Historia Eclesiástica ), which was raised in 1996 to the Peruvian Academy of Church History ( Academia Peruana de Historia Eclesiástica ) and editor of the Revista Peruana de Academy magazine Historia Eclesiástica.

On April 10, 1999 Pope John Paul II accepted his resignation age-related.

Awards and honors

  • Medalla de Oro de Santo Toribio de Mogrovejo (Peru, 2002)
  • Corresponding Member of the Academia Nacional de la Historia Peruvian
  • Medalla de oro de la ciudad del Cuzco
  • Member of the Instituto Americano de Arte de la Ciudad Imperial
  • Consultant to the Pontifical Commission for the Cultural Heritage of the Church
  • Honorary doctorate from the National University of San Antonio Abad in Cusco (2009)

Writings

  • Los Mercedarios en los Concilios limenses, 1973
  • Valores y humanos & Religious del Inca Garcilaso de la Vega, 1989
  • Los Mercedarios en la Universidad de San Marcos de Lima, 1999
  • Homenaje al R. P. Doctor Antonio San Cristóbal Sebastián, Universidad Nacional de San Agustín 2000
  • El clero y la de Túpac Amaru rebelión, Volume 1 of Colección Pachatusan 2000
  • La orden de la Merced en el Perú: estudos históricos, Volume 2, Provincia del Perú Mercedaria 2001
  • José Pérez Armendáriz: obispo del Cuzco y de la Independencia del Peru precursor, volume 3 of Colección Pachatusan 2002
  • Siete Obispos cuzqueños de la colonia, Volume 2 of Colección Pachatusan 2002 ( )
  • Siervo de Dios P. Francisco Salamanca, Volume 4 of Colección Pachatusan 2006
  • El arzobispo Goyoneche ante las dificultades de la iglesia del Perú antes las dificultades de la Iglesia del Perú, 1816-1872, 2006 ( )
